On March 28, 2025, the exchange rate for the US Dollar (USD) against the Pakistani Rupee (PKR) in the open market showed fluctuations influenced by economic conditions and market demand.
As of 8:10 AM Pakistan Standard Time (PST), the buying rate for one US Dollar was recorded at Rs 279.68, while the selling rate stood at Rs 281.97. These rates reflect the value at which financial institutions and exchange companies facilitate transactions with customers.
Compared to the previous trading day, the exchange rate remained relatively stable, with the buying price of the US Dollar on March 27, 2025, standing at Rs 279.68, while the selling price was slightly lower at Rs 281.94.
